Check the fit before you buy an office chair

Almost every office chair on Amazon is sold as ergonomic. The word has no set meaning. Two plain numbers decide if a chair fits you. One is how low and high the seat goes. The other is how deep the seat is. Of the six popular chairs we read up on, four listings showed a single seat height instead of a range, and only one listing showed a seat that adjusts for depth.

A person who is 5 ft 8 in needs a seat height of about 18 inches and a seat no deeper than about 18 inches, by our rule of thumb. A person who is 5 ft 2 in needs about 16.5 and 16. The fixed seats on our shortlist run from 17.72 to 20 inches deep, so the second person has far fewer choices.
